1. Define Your Brand Identity
Before you post anything, make sure your brand has a clear and consistent identity.
- What is your brand voice — friendly, professional, witty, or bold?
- What colors, fonts, and styles reflect your brand personality?
- What values do you want to communicate through your content?
Consistency builds recognition — and recognition builds loyalty.
2. Choose the Right Platforms
You don’t have to be everywhere — just where your audience is. Here’s how you can decide:
- Instagram: Great for visual brands and storytelling.
- LinkedIn: Best for B2B marketing and professional networking.
- Facebook: Ideal for community building and targeted ads.
- X (Twitter): Perfect for real-time engagement and updates.
- TikTok / YouTube: Best for video-driven audiences.
Each platform has its strengths, so choose wisely to maximize engagement.
3. Develop a Content Strategy
A solid social media strategy includes the right balance of:
- Educational content (tips, insights, tutorials)
- Inspirational content (stories, achievements, quotes)
- Promotional content (offers, product highlights, testimonials)
- Interactive content (polls, Q&A, reels, contests)
✨ Tip: Use a content calendar to stay organized and consistent. Tools like Buffer, Later, or Hootsuite can help you schedule and track posts efficiently.
4. Engage with Your Audience
Social media isn’t just about posting — it’s about connecting. Respond to comments, reply to DMs, and participate in conversations. The more genuine your interaction, the more trust you’ll build.

5. Track, Analyze, and Optimize
Measure your performance regularly using tools like:
- Meta Business Suite (Facebook & Instagram)
- LinkedIn Analytics
- Google Analytics (for traffic tracking)
Look at metrics like engagement rate, reach, followers, and conversions. Then adjust your strategy based on what’s working best.
6. Stay Consistent & Authentic
Building a social media presence is a long-term effort. Consistency in tone, visuals, and posting frequency is key. Don’t try to be everything to everyone — be authentic, relatable, and human.
